hp-sw-init.patch - this is a priority-group module for the HP storage
works device. I have only tested this with scsi_debug, so I know that
the start_stop is making its way to scsi and is returning safely.
example table:
0 16380 multipath 2 hp-storage-works 0 round-robin 0 2 /dev/sda /dev/sdb
hp-storage-works 0 round-robin 0 2 /dev/sdc /dev/sdd
name of group="hp-storage-works"
num of groups args=0
